Weirdology

This event is part of the Royal Society’s 2021 Summer Science digital showcase.
Explore the strange chemistry, materials science, physics and biology lurking in everyday things… this is a show for people who think they hate science.
Join Gastronaut Stefan Gates and his long-suffering daughter Poppy for an unforgettable adventure through strange and wonderful chemistry, biology and physics as they tackle questions such as Why can’t you melt a Flake? What are bogies for? Can you make screaming hot plasma in a microwave?
Full of ridiculous and shocking demos, hacks, myth busting and self-experimentation, this is an action-packed family science show that will light the touchpaper of fascination in anyone.
BBC Gastronaut Stefan Gates is renowned for his world-class science and food shows.
